Role:Associate Manager - Costing Base location:Pawane, Navi Mumbai, India Reporting to :DGM - FinanceKey Responsibilities Product Cost Monitoring Monitor and analyze per unit cost for Jejuri manufacturing operations on a regular basis. Track cost drivers including raw materials, conversion cost, overhead absorption, and yield variances. Identify cost trends and deviations, and recommend corrective actions. Shadow Cost Computation (Transfer Pricing Products) Compute shadow costs for transfer pricing (TP) products in line with group policies and statutory requirements. Support TP documentation with accurate and auditable cost calculations. Coordinate with tax and compliance teams for TP reviews and audits. Change Control & Pricing Support Evaluate cost and pricing impact for change control initiatives (BOM changes, process changes, vendor changes, capacity changes, etc.). Provide inputs from a costing and pricing perspective to cross-functional stakeholders (Manufacturing, SCM, Marketing, R&D). Ensure timely updates to standard costs post approval. FOB Computation & Pricing Revisions Perform quarterly FOB (Free on Board) computation for export products. Support periodic revision of pricing based on cost movements, forex impact, and margin expectations. Ensure alignment between costing, pricing, and commercial teams. AOP Costing Support Compute FOB and product costs for AOP (Annual Operating Plan) purposes. Support budget preparation, scenario analysis, and sensitivity analysis. Ensure consistency between actuals, forecasts, and AOP assumptions. MIS & Variance Analysis Ensure timely and accurate MIS reporting to management. Conduct detailed variance analysis (Actual vs Standard / Budget / Previous Period). Highlight key cost variances with actionable insights and improvement opportunities. Period-End Closing Activities Manage month-end and quarter-end closing activities related to costing. Ensure accurate inventory valuation, WIP calculation, and cost absorption. Coordinate with plant finance and corporate finance for timely closure. Cost Benchmarking Perform cost benchmarking across geographies (NIM / Angola / DRC vs India). Analyze structural cost differences and identify optimization opportunities. Provide comparative insights to management for strategic decision-making. SAP CO Module Ownership Act as SAP CO (Controlling) module owner. Ensure accuracy of cost centers, profit centers, product costing, and reporting structures. Support system enhancements, master data governance, and user training. Coordinate with IT and external consultants for SAP changes and issue resolution. Key Skills & Competencies Strong knowledge of cost accounting, product costing, and management accounting Hands-on experience with SAP CO module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ills Strong business partnering and stakeholder management abilities Advanced proficiency in Excel and MIS reporting Understanding of transfer pricing and export pricing concepts Qualifications & Experience CA / CMA / MBA (Finance) preferred 5–8 years of relevant experience in manufacturing / FMCG / pharma / industrial environment Experience in multi-location or international operations is an advantage
